| Week | Date | Quiz | Topic | Chapters |
| 1 | 4 Mar | course intro, digital information, sampling, quantization, Nyquist rate | 3.1, 3.3.2, 3.3.3, 3.5.1 | |
| 2 | 9 Mar | Q1 | time and frequency domains | 3.3.1 |
| 11 Mar | time and frequency domains, Nyquist rate, Shannon channel capacity | 3.1, 3.5 | ||
| 3 | 16 Mar | Q2 | Shannon review, ASK/FSK/PSK | 3.7, 3.7.1 |
| 18 Mar | ASK/FSK/PSK, QAM, constellations | 3.7.2 | ||
| 4 | 23 Mar | Q3 | QAM, constellations, line coding | 3.6, 3.7.2 |
| 25 Mar | line coding, key concepts for error detection | 3.6 | ||
| 5 | 30 Mar | Q4 | error detection: parity and checksum | 3.9.1, 3.9.3 |
| 1 Apr | Hamming distance, error correction, 2D parity, voting | 3.9.1, 3.9.2 | ||
| 6 | 6 Apr | Q5 | (review) | |
| 8 Apr | MIDTERM | |||
| 7 | 13 Apr | Midterm and Assignment 1 solutions | ||
| 15 Apr | network intro, OSI layers, ethernet LAN example | 1.1, 2.2, 2.3 | ||
| 8 | 20 Apr | Q6 | layers, example continued, encapsulation between layers | 1.1, 2.2, 2.3 |
| 22 Apr | communication between many machines: overview, ALOHA | 6.1, 6.2 | ||
| 9 | 27 Apr | Q7 | ALOHA, CSMA, CSMA-CD | 6.2 |
| 29 Apr | performance analysis of ALOHA and SL-ALOHA | 6.2 | ||
| 10 | 4 May | Q8 | course evaluation, performance analysis of (SL-)ALOHA and CSMA-CD | 6.2 |
| 6 May | recap of ethernet/IP-network architecture, switching and routing intro, MAC/LLC sublayers | 6.6, 6.11 | ||
| 11 | 11 May | Q9 | ethernet/LLC/SNAP frames | 6.7.1, 6.7.2 |
| 13 May | ethernet review, IP/TCP/UDP intro, IP packets and addresses, ARP intro | 8.1, 8.2.1, 8.2.2, 8.2.6 | ||
| 12 | 18 May | (Victoria Day holiday) | ||
| 20 May | Q10 | (review) | ||
| 22 May | FINAL EXAM (3:30-6:30pm, SLH B) | |||